Job Overview

The Production Technician will engage in various tasks involving the assembly of manufactured and procured components into subassemblies or complete products. These products may encompass mechanical, electrical, or hybrid systems. This role offers the potential for skill development leading to advancement opportunities within the assembly classification.

A Day In The Life

Utilize blueprints and routing documents to fabricate components according to specified standards.

Ensure the quality of the assemblies produced by conducting initial and ongoing inspections to maintain overall product integrity. Take responsibility for routine maintenance and uphold a tidy work environment. Adhere to all operational protocols regarding machinery and safety measures. Maintain basic records related to productivity, quality, and safety.

What Will Help You Thrive in This Role?

Possess the necessary skills and capabilities to assemble manufactured and procured components into subassemblies or complete products.

Must be equipped with all essential tools required for job functions. Proficient in operating assembly machinery such as riveting machines, assembly presses, and power tools.

Physical capability to perform tasks that involve frequent standing, sitting, bending, as well as pushing, pulling, and lifting items weighing up to 30 lbs. on a regular basis. Adequate reading and writing skills to follow work instructions and prepare basic production documentation. Sufficient visual acuity (with correction) to read instructions, operate machinery, and inspect components. Adequate manual dexterity to operate equipment effectively.

About Hubbell Incorporated

Hubbell is dedicated to creating essential infrastructure solutions that empower our customers, communities, and the planet. Our organization is strategically focused on facilitating grid modernization and electrification.

As the demand for reliable energy solutions increases, Hubbell's offerings support the transition to a more dependable, resilient, and efficient energy infrastructure.

Founded in 1888, our innovative approach has established us as a leading global manufacturer of high-quality electrical and utility solutions, enabling customers to manage critical infrastructure effectively and efficiently.

Our Business Segments

Hubbell operates in two primary segments:

  • Hubbell Utility Solutions (HUS): Enabling the grid to conduct, communicate, and control energy across utility applications.
  • Hubbell Electrical Solutions (HES): Essential for managing power across diverse industries and applications.

Our vertical market solutions cater to sectors including Data Centers, Renewables, Commercial Buildings, Industrial, Telecom, and Transportation.

Supporting both business segments are our corporate and Hubbell Unified Business Solutions teams, which provide consistent processes, tools, and technologies across our operations.
